package merlin-lib
Merlin's libraries
Install
Dune Dependency
Authors
Maintainers
Sources
merlin-4.19-414.tbz
sha256=60a630f59203a9ce7047a5f04d0f239945960dac6f38102922e328b6d2657384
sha512=19f8ec152356873e29c05b971a529146bb7079929037c2b35a5c0afb0b3adf662341ee8527282c5fdd16de391d01c2c469fc8629af9e0ae443fa9f42472b70bb
doc/merlin-lib.ocaml_parsing/Ocaml_parsing/Builtin_attributes/index.html
Module Ocaml_parsing.Builtin_attributes
Source
Support for some of the builtin attributes
- ocaml.deprecated
- ocaml.alert
- ocaml.error
- ocaml.ppwarning
- ocaml.warning
- ocaml.warnerror
- ocaml.explicit_arity (for camlp4/camlp5)
- ocaml.warn_on_literal_pattern
- ocaml.deprecated_mutable
- ocaml.immediate
- ocaml.immediate64
- ocaml.boxed / ocaml.unboxed
Warning: this module is unstable and part of compiler-libs.
Source
val check_alerts_inclusion :
def:Location.t ->
use:Location.t ->
Location.t ->
Parsetree.attributes ->
Parsetree.attributes ->
string ->
unit
Source
val check_deprecated_mutable_inclusion :
def:Location.t ->
use:Location.t ->
Location.t ->
Parsetree.attributes ->
Parsetree.attributes ->
string ->
unit
Apply warning settings from the specified attribute. "ocaml.warning"/"ocaml.warnerror" (and variants without the prefix) are processed and other attributes are ignored.
Also implement ocaml.ppwarning (unless ~ppwarning:false is passed).
Execute a function in a new scope for warning settings. This means that the effect of any call to warning_attribute
during the execution of this function will be discarded after execution.
The function also takes a list of attributes which are processed with warning_attribute
in the fresh scope before the function is executed.
sectionYPositions = computeSectionYPositions($el), 10)"
x-init="setTimeout(() => sectionYPositions = computeSectionYPositions($el), 10)"
>